Mura CMS 6.1

mura.extend
Class extendManager

railo-context.Component
        extended by mura.cfobject
            extended by mura.extend.extendManager

public class extendManager
extends cfobject

Constructor Summary
init([any configBean])
 
Method Summary
 any buildDefinitionsQuery(any datasource='[runtime expression]', any dbUsername='[runtime expression]', any dbPassword='[runtime expression]')
 any buildIconClassLookup()
 void deleteExtendedData([any baseid], any dataTable='tclassextenddata')
 array deleteSubType([any subTypeID])
 string getAttribute(any baseID='', any key='', any dataTable='tclassextenddata')
 any getCastString([any attribute], [any siteID], [any datatype])
 any getCustomIconClass([any type], [any subtype], [any siteid])
 any getDefinitionsQuery()
 query getExtendedAttributeList([any siteID], any baseTable='tcontent', any activeOnly='false')
 any getExtendedData([any baseID], any dataTable='tclassextenddata', [any type], [any subtype], [any siteid], [any sourceIterator=''])
 string getIconClass([any type], [any subtype], [any siteid])
 any getIconClassLookUp()
 any getSubTypeBean()
 any getSubTypeByID([any subTypeID])
 any getSubTypeByName([any type], [any subtype], [any siteid])
 query getSubTypes([any siteid], [any activeOnly='false'])
 query getSubTypesByType([any type], [any siteid], [any activeOnly='false'])
 string getTypeAsString([any type])
 any loadConfigXML([any configXML], [any siteID])
 void preserveExtendedData([any baseID], any preserveID='', [any data], any dataTable='tclassextenddata', any type='', any subtype='')
 any purgeDefinitionsQuery()
 any resetTypedData([any type='both'])
 void saveAttributeSort([any attributeID])
 void saveExtendedData([any baseID], [any data], any dataTable='tclassextenddata')
 void saveExtendSetSort([any extendSetID])
 void saveRelatedSetSort([any relatedContentSetID])
 void setConfigBean([any configBean])
 any setIconClass([any type], [any subtype], [any siteid], [any iconclass])
 any syncDefinitions([any fromSiteID=''], [any toSiteID=''], [any type=''], [any subType=''])
 any validateExtendedData([any data])
 
Methods inherited from class mura.cfobject
commitTracePoint, deleteMethod, getAsJSON, getAsStruct, getBean, getConfigBean, getCurrentUser, getEventManager, getPlugin, getPluginManager, getServiceFactory, getValue, initTracePoint, injectMethod, invokeMethod, removeValue, setValue, valueExists
 
Methods inherited from class railo-context.Component
 

Constructor Detail

init

public init([any configBean])

Parameters:
configBean
Method Detail

buildDefinitionsQuery

public any buildDefinitionsQuery(any datasource='[runtime expression]', any dbUsername='[runtime expression]', any dbPassword='[runtime expression]')

Parameters:
datasource
dbUsername
dbPassword

buildIconClassLookup

public any buildIconClassLookup()


deleteExtendedData

public void deleteExtendedData([any baseid], any dataTable='tclassextenddata')

Parameters:
baseid
dataTable

deleteSubType

public array deleteSubType([any subTypeID])

Parameters:
subTypeID

getAttribute

public string getAttribute(any baseID='', any key='', any dataTable='tclassextenddata')

Parameters:
baseID
key
dataTable

getCastString

public any getCastString([any attribute], [any siteID], [any datatype])

Parameters:
attribute
siteID
datatype

getCustomIconClass

public any getCustomIconClass([any type], [any subtype], [any siteid])

Parameters:
type
subtype
siteid

getDefinitionsQuery

public any getDefinitionsQuery()


getExtendedAttributeList

public query getExtendedAttributeList([any siteID], any baseTable='tcontent', any activeOnly='false')

Parameters:
siteID
baseTable
activeOnly

getExtendedData

public any getExtendedData([any baseID], any dataTable='tclassextenddata', [any type], [any subtype], [any siteid], [any sourceIterator=''])

Parameters:
baseID
dataTable
type
subtype
siteid
sourceIterator

getIconClass

public string getIconClass([any type], [any subtype], [any siteid])

Parameters:
type
subtype
siteid

getIconClassLookUp

public any getIconClassLookUp()


getSubTypeBean

public any getSubTypeBean()


getSubTypeByID

public any getSubTypeByID([any subTypeID])

Parameters:
subTypeID

getSubTypeByName

public any getSubTypeByName([any type], [any subtype], [any siteid])

Parameters:
type
subtype
siteid

getSubTypes

public query getSubTypes([any siteid], [any activeOnly='false'])

Parameters:
siteid
activeOnly

getSubTypesByType

public query getSubTypesByType([any type], [any siteid], [any activeOnly='false'])

Parameters:
type
siteid
activeOnly

getTypeAsString

public string getTypeAsString([any type])

Parameters:
type

loadConfigXML

public any loadConfigXML([any configXML], [any siteID])

Parameters:
configXML
siteID

preserveExtendedData

public void preserveExtendedData([any baseID], any preserveID='', [any data], any dataTable='tclassextenddata', any type='', any subtype='')

Parameters:
baseID
preserveID
data
dataTable
type
subtype

purgeDefinitionsQuery

public any purgeDefinitionsQuery()


resetTypedData

public any resetTypedData([any type='both'])

Parameters:
type

saveAttributeSort

public void saveAttributeSort([any attributeID])

Parameters:
attributeID

saveExtendedData

public void saveExtendedData([any baseID], [any data], any dataTable='tclassextenddata')

Parameters:
baseID
data
dataTable

saveExtendSetSort

public void saveExtendSetSort([any extendSetID])

Parameters:
extendSetID

saveRelatedSetSort

public void saveRelatedSetSort([any relatedContentSetID])

Parameters:
relatedContentSetID

setConfigBean

public void setConfigBean([any configBean])

Parameters:
configBean

setIconClass

public any setIconClass([any type], [any subtype], [any siteid], [any iconclass])

Parameters:
type
subtype
siteid
iconclass

syncDefinitions

public any syncDefinitions([any fromSiteID=''], [any toSiteID=''], [any type=''], [any subType=''])

Parameters:
fromSiteID
toSiteID
type
subType

validateExtendedData

public any validateExtendedData([any data])

Parameters:
data

Mura CMS 6.1